I was overwhelmed by the number of people I know who came to help support Dining Out For Life last night at ACME Chophouse. Perhaps the most important guest, was the last to arrive, a young gentleman, known to Becks & Posh readers as Tim.

Tim is just a regular young guy. Good looking with a gorgeous girlfriend, I met him a few years ago at Industrial Light and Magic when he was moved into the office I sat in. As the legend goes, one day he said to me "Why don't you start a blog?" "What's a blog?" I responded... And the rest is history.

So last night, seeing Tim sitting somewhere near the center of the restaurant with tables and tables full of food bloggers and their friends around him, it occured to me that without him none of this would have happened. Tim is the pivot that led to this blog and therefore eventually to everything that occurred last night. Almost three years ago he started the incredible chain of events that led to so many wonderful friendships and to over 40 people, bloggers, their friends and even readers (hello Sarah!) coming to dinner at ACME Chophouse. I have a lot to thank him for.
